Stewart Rudnicki manages the daily operations of ICCB-Longwood, an academic small molecule and siRNA high-throughput screening facility at Harvard Medical School: "This includes our automated equipment, compound management, and data coordination with the informatics group, as well as assisting scientists with assay development, instruction in equipment use, and tours of the screening facility."

As part of his role, Stewart needs to be fully aware of all available technologies so he can make purchases and advise colleagues. "I need to be fully informed about the latest products for basic research, drug discovery and clinical applications," he said.

About ICCB-Longwood

The Institute of Chemistry and Cell Biology (ICCB)-Longwood Screening Facility was one of the first high-throughput screening facilities to be opened in an academic setting, serving primarily Harvard Medical School and Harvard-affiliated hospital researchers. The facility employs a staff-assisted screening model, in which investigators using the facility are provided with access to compound and siRNA libraries, and training in the use of some instruments, such as liquid handling equipment, plate readers, and screening microscopes.
